2. What are the operating temperature ranges for the ULT and LT series?
The ULT series is designed for ultra-low temperature requirements, covering a range from -200°C to 125°C. The LT series is suitable for low-temperature applications from -50°C to 105°C.
3. In which industrial applications are these insulation materials commonly used?
They are widely applied in coal chemical MOT, low-temperature storage tanks, FPSO unloading systems, industrial gas and agricultural chemical facilities, platform pipes, gas stations, ethylene pipes, LNG systems, and nitrogen plants.

5. How does the insulation material perform in terms of moisture prevention?
The LT series maintains high wet resistance with a factor of >10000 and a low water vapor permeability coefficient of 0.0039g/h.m² (under 25mm thickness), ensuring stable thermal performance in humid conditions.
